Abstract

A control unit stores a count value, which is used to detect an operational position of a roof glass, in a RAM. The control unit determines whether the count value is properly stored in the RAM when a voltage of a power supply falls below a predetermined voltage and thereafter returns to the predetermined voltage. Even in a case where the control unit determines that the count value is properly stored in the RAM, the control unit determines there is a possibility of having a deviation between an actual operational position of the roof glass and the count value. Thereafter, the control unit resets a reference point of the roof glass.
